Last Thursday kicked off the 2023 Women’s World Cup, and the No. 1-ranked U.S. Women’s National Team is prepared to clinch a third consecutive victory (that would be their fifth FIFA World Cup win overall!). Here are a few places downtown where you can cheer on the team!

Tom’s Watch Bar

Tom’s at Coors Field will be hosting watch parties throughout the game series. Pro soccer players, like Jennifer Muñoz and Tara McKeown, will be in attendance at some of the parties to join the festivities and sign autographs.

DNVR Bar

The Colorado Rapids Soccer Club will be tuning into the tournament at THE local sports bar for Denver diehards, where a premium viewing experience is complete with comfy seating, endless screens, and classic stadium eats, like wings, burgers, hot dogs, and brewskis.

Tight End

Denver’s only gay sports bar will be showing the games all week. Here, you’ll find nine TVs, a full beer and cocktail list, and (most importantly) a safe space where everyone is welcome! (Also check out Altitude FC, Denver’s LGBTQIA+ soccer club and nonprofit.)

Raíces Brewing Co.

This Sun Valley-based, Latino-owned brewpub is one of the most popular destinations for soccer matches, thanks to their killer vibes and signature cervezas. Oh, and be sure to grab an empanada or pretzel while you’re there.

Number Thirty Eight

With a massive outdoor space and a giant projector screen for the game, you’re guaranteed good views and a great time at this hoppin’ indoor / outdoor RiNo entertainment venue.

Celtic on Market

As the biggest soccer bar in the city, Celtic on Market invites you to experience a “true football atmosphere” with more than 40 televisions, two floors of entertainment, and a charming Irish-inspired pub featuring delicious food and an expansive beer list.
